CHAPTER 316
(House Bill 351)
AN ACT concerning
Talbot County - Hotel Rental Tax Rate
FOR the purpose of altering the maximum hotel rental tax rate in Talbot County; and
generally relating to the maximum hotel rental tax rate in Talbot County.
BY repealing and reenacting, with amendments,
Article 24 - Political Subdivisions — Miscellaneous Provisions
Section 9-304(b)(11)
Annotated Code of Maryland
(2005 Replacement Volume)
SECTION 1. BE IT ENACTED BY TH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F
MARYLAND, That the Laws of Maryland read as follows:
Article 24 - Political Subdivisions - Miscellaneous Provisions
9-304.
(b) An authorized county may not set a hotel rental tax rate that exceeds:
(11) [In] 4% IN Talbot County[:
(i) 4% from January 1, 2005 through December 31, 2006; and
(ii) 3% on or after January 1, 2007]; and
SECTION 2. AND BE IT FURTHER ENACTED, That this Act shall take effect
October 1, 2006.
Approved May 2, 2006.
